New Meeting Format This Year

  • This year, we are introducing a new format for the Spring Meeting. Instead of section breakouts, we will host plenary sessions organized by section chairs, featuring topics of broad interest to our membership. Medical malpractice section members will still have the option to attend breakout sessions on Thursday afternoon and Friday morning. 

  • Plenary topics will include a legislative update and an appellate court update, featuring two Court of Appeals judges. Additionally, due to the success of our dine-arounds, we are excited to include them in the Spring Meeting this year.

Hotel


The Virginian Hotel
Lynchburg


An eminent feature of Lynchburg since 1913, the Virginian Hotel combines historic detail with modern style. Discover the James River Heritage Trail and the city's arts district just steps from their door. Skyline Grill provides exclusive views as downtown Lynchburg's only rooftop restaurant and The William Henry Steakhouse, created by two seasoned steakhouse operators, brings an exceptional menu in a warm and inviting dining room.
